Fine Art, Old Masters, Islamic Art, and Antiques. Including items from Captain Cook’s Circumnavigation aboard HMS Resolution 1772-1775.

This sale features a hitherto unseen collection of artefacts collected by Admiral Richard Grindall (1750 - 1820) whilst he was an Able Seaman aboard the Resolution on Captain James Cook's second circumnavigation; as well as artefacts collected by Rivers Grindall, son of Richard Grindall, during his service abroad, including in India.
